Editors' roundtable

How should you budget a flooring project?

Homeowners budget for the flooring they can see and forget the subfloor they can't. Our editors on how to weigh both.

The longevity case

Solid hardwood costs more but can be refinished for decades and adds resale value. If you're staying put, the higher upfront price amortizes well.

The material-value case

Laminate and luxury vinyl deliver a hardwood look for a fraction of the price and handle moisture better — the value pick for busy homes and tight budgets.

The hidden-cost case

The surprise isn't the flooring — it's the subfloor. Budget for leveling, removal and disposal; a bid that ignores them will be "revised" mid-job.

Our take

Pick material by how long you'll stay and how hard the floor will work, then budget for subfloor prep up front. The cheapest material over an ignored subfloor is the most expensive mistake.
